Transaction 5011545887e149af7085bbc9e3354a63c18214ea65715751084b71977b21a752

1 Input
2 Outputs
  • 5011545887e149af7085bbc9e3354a63c18214ea65715751084b71977b21a752:0
  • value  2356157
    address  1AETPR4jeVH5MWyctudT67FYFg6UnHxyf8
  • 5011545887e149af7085bbc9e3354a63c18214ea65715751084b71977b21a752:1
  • value  2188096
    address  1Hmd9rXS4WM5NWPeehG2egYviywSAZ9Xx7